Robert McCarron works in the field of Internal Medicine. Doctor Robert A. McCarron, MD accepts Medicare payments and is listed with Medicare.gov.
|
Dr. Annetta C. Alexander, MD
This Doctor is OpenDoctor Recommended.
|
|
Dr. Scott W. Snedeker, MD
This Doctor is OpenDoctor Recommended.
This doctor has more publications
|
|
Dr. Guy R. Ulrich, MD
This Doctor is OpenDoctor Recommended.
|
|
Dr. Dennis C. King, MD
This Doctor is OpenDoctor Recommended.
|
|
Dr. Erol R. Atamer, MD
This Doctor is OpenDoctor Recommended.
This doctor has more publications
|
|
Dr. Joshua B. Shipley, MD
This Doctor is OpenDoctor Recommended.
|
|
Dr. Bradley A. Kast, DO
This Doctor is OpenDoctor Recommended.
|
|
Dr. Melissa Dean, MD
This Doctor is OpenDoctor Recommended.
|
|
Dr. Marie-France J. Scherer, MD
This Doctor is OpenDoctor Recommended.
|
|
Dr. Sarah J. Smalley, MD
This Doctor is OpenDoctor Recommended.
|
|
Dr. Saurav R. Baral, MD
|
|
Dr. George A. Mitchell, DO
This Doctor is OpenDoctor Recommended.
|
|
Dr. Heather D. Owens, MD
This Doctor is OpenDoctor Recommended.
|